Assessing the Risks and Potential Side Effects Associated with Supplement Usage
While the benefits of supplements in esports culture are evident, it is crucial to approach their use with caution. Over-reliance on supplements can lead to a variety of adverse effects. For example, excessive intake of caffeine may lead to dehydration, insomnia, and heightened anxiety, undermining the focus that players aim to achieve. This concern is particularly significant in the high-pressure environment of esports, where maintaining mental sharpness is vital for success.
Many gamers might overlook the risk of developing a dependency on energy drinks and cognitive enhancers. Such dependencies can have lasting repercussions on mental health, potentially leading to cycles of fatigue and an increased reliance on stimulants to perform. The delicate balance between striving for peak performance and preserving health necessitates that players remain vigilant to the fine line separating beneficial support from harmful consumption patterns.
Additionally, the unregulated nature of the supplement industry can exacerbate these risks. Products marketed as performance enhancers may contain unverified ingredients or harmful substances that could jeopardise players' eligibility to compete. By raising awareness of these potential hazards and proactively managing their supplement intake, athletes can protect themselves against negative health outcomes while aiming to excel in their gaming careers.

The Impact of Energy Drinks and Caffeine on Esports Performance
The prevalence of energy drinks in supplements in esports culture is significant and cannot be overstated. These beverages, typically packed with caffeine and sugar, have become a staple for many gamers seeking an instant energy boost. Caffeine is lauded for its ability to enhance alertness, focus, and reaction times, making it a popular choice among competitive players. However, the consumption of energy drinks should be approached with caution due to potential negative effects that may arise, particularly with excessive intake.
While energy drinks provide immediate energy benefits, they can lead to energy crashes if not managed judiciously. The high sugar content in many energy drinks can cause rapid fluctuations in energy levels, resulting in fatigue and diminished performance once the initial boost subsides. Additionally, overdependence on these products can lead to tolerance, requiring larger doses to achieve the desired effects.
Gamers should consider moderating their intake of energy drinks and exploring alternative sources of caffeine. Options such as coffee or specially formulated nootropic supplements may provide a more stable energy source without the accompanying sugar crash. Balancing caffeine consumption with adequate hydration and nutrient-dense foods can enhance performance while reducing the risks associated with energy drinks.

Investigating Nootropics and Cognitive Enhancers for Performance Enhancement
The market for nootropics and cognitive enhancers is rapidly expanding within supplements in esports culture, as gamers seek to optimise their mental performance. Nootropics, often referred to as “smart drugs,” are substances that can enhance cognitive functions such as memory, focus, and creativity. Many esports players are gravitating towards these products in hopes of securing a competitive advantage.
Popular nootropic ingredients include L-theanine, Rhodiola Rosea, and Alpha-GPC. L-theanine, commonly found in tea, encourages relaxation without causing drowsiness. When combined with caffeine, it may enhance focus and alertness while reducing jitters. Rhodiola Rosea is prized for its adaptogenic properties, aiding in the reduction of fatigue and bolstering mental resilience under stress.
Despite the promising potential of nootropics, their efficacy and safety can vary widely. Continued research into the long-term effects of these substances is essential, and users should exercise caution. Consulting with healthcare professionals and conducting thorough research can empower gamers to make informed decisions about incorporating nootropics into their routines. By carefully managing their supplement use, esports athletes can harness the cognitive benefits these products offer while prioritising their health and safety.

Enhancing Sleep Quality and Recovery via Supplementation
Adequate sleep is critical for optimal performance; however, many esports athletes encounter sleep disturbances due to erratic gaming schedules. Certain supplements in esports culture can assist in improving sleep quality and facilitating recovery. Melatonin, a hormone that regulates sleep-wake cycles, is frequently employed by gamers to promote restful sleep, especially following late-night gaming sessions.
The significance of sleep in cognitive function and overall health cannot be overstated. Inadequate sleep can result in diminished concentration, slower reaction times, and increased vulnerability to stress. By prioritising sleep hygiene and incorporating sleep-enhancing supplements, esports athletes can optimise their recovery processes, ensuring they remain mentally sharp and physically prepared for competition.
Nevertheless, it is essential to approach sleep supplements with caution. Overreliance on melatonin or other sleep aids can lead to dependency and disrupt natural sleep patterns. Establishing a consistent sleep routine, alongside strategic supplement use, can help gamers achieve restorative sleep without compromising their health in the long run.
